Our Mission

"To facilitate and fund social, educational and cultural endeavors

that enhance the quality of life in Villa Park."


 The specific purposes for which the VPCS FOUNDATION was formed include the following

• To provide safe recreational and other community activity opportunities for youth, adults, and seniors.

• To coordinate the planning, preservation, and presentation of leisure, historical, music, and/or arts programs within the City of Villa Park.

• To coordinate the use and development of community resources to promote and support activities which advance the overall quality of life in the City of Villa Park.

  • To own and maintain suitable real and personal property which is deemed necessary for the purpose of this Foundation.

•To receive, hold, and disburse gifts, bequests, devises, and other funds to advance the purpose of the Foundation.


What is the Purpose of the Foundation?

Villa Park is known as a family town. The Foundation is committed to planning, underwriting and presentation of safe recreational and educational activities for youth, adults and seniors. Other focal points are the procurements and coordination of community use and/or development of tangible resources. Partnering with the City of Villa Park, our local groups and schools plus organizations such as the Villa Park Women’s League and Rotary Club of Villa Park, promotes mutual support, genuine goodwill and increased volunteerism throughout the community.

What is the Foundation?

Established by the City of Villa Park in 2002, it is a 501c3 charitable, non profit organization designed to increase the potential of citizen volunteerism and special events without major city expense. Membership, sponsorship and donations to the Foundation are tax deductible, to the extent permitted under the law.

Who administers the Foundation?

When founded, there were just five Board of Directors and two City council members. Operations are now administered by twelve Directors appointed by the VP City Council, plus two council members. Meetings are usually held on the fourth Wednesday of each month. All board members volunteer their efforts. Board positions are open periodically. Who funds the Foundation?

Throughout the years, the Foundation has successfully requested County of Orange supervisors, public utilities, corporations and businesses serving our city as well as residents to share in the enthusiasm of the Foundation by supporting its efforts through donations and yearly memberships. Depending upon their “jewel” level of giving, donors are provided opportunities for recognition in Foundation publicity and at events. Invitations to special receptions or VIP access may also reflect their generosity. The Foundation operational funds are also received through the underwriting of special events. Current financial information is posted on this website and reviewed /approved at monthly board meetings.
